    Phase 1: Low-Fidelity Wireframing

    Low-fi wireframes are the skeleton of your prototype. They ignore color and details to focus on layout, hierarchy, and user flow. In 2026, 80% of successful prototypes start with paper or grayscale wireframes before any pixel pushing.

    Tactic 1.1: Sketch User Flows

    Why this works: Mapping user flows prevents disoriented navigation. A 2024 UX Collective study found that teams who sketch flows first reduce later redesigns by 40%.

    Exactly how to do it:

    1. List the 5 key user goals (e.g., sign up, make a purchase).
    2. For each goal, write the steps the user takes.
    3. Draw rectangles for each screen, connect with arrows.
    4. Identify decision points (e.g., login vs. guest).
    5. Review with a colleague for logic gaps.
    6. Iterate until the flow feels natural.
    7. Save as a reference for wireframe layout.

    Pro script / template: “Open Figma, create a new file, and name it ‘User Flows’. Use the Connector tool (Shift+C) to link frames. Each frame should represent a screen, and arrows should be labeled with the trigger.”

    📊 Expected results: Clear navigation logic, reduced confusion — complete in 30 minutes.

    Tactic 1.2: Create Grayscale Wireframes

    Why this works: Grayscale forces you to focus on layout and contrast, not color. It’s the industry standard for early-stage prototyping.

    Exactly how to do it:

    1. Use the Frame tool (F) with device presets (e.g., iPhone 14, desktop).
    2. Add gray rectangles for images (fill #e0e0e0).
    3. Use text placeholders (lorem ipsum) for headlines.
    4. Use line icons or simple shapes for buttons.
    5. Name layers clearly (e.g., “Header”, “Product Card”).
    6. Avoid rounded corners until Phase 2.
    7. Keep to 3 font sizes: heading, body, small.

    Pro script / template: “Set up a 4-column grid for the homepage (header, hero, features, footer). Use the Rectangle tool (R) to draw blocks at 50% opacity so you can see lines through them.”

    📊 Expected results: 10-15 wireframes in 1 hour, ready for review.

    Tactic 1.3: Add Rough Interaction Hints

    Why this works: Even low-fi prototypes benefit from basic links. Stakeholders can click through and spot flow issues early.

    Exactly how to do it:

    1. Open the Prototype tab (right panel).
    2. Select a button or link.
    3. Drag the blue circle to the destination wireframe.
    4. Set interaction to “Navigate to” with “Instant” animation.
    5. Test using the Present icon (play button).
    6. Share link with stakeholders for quick feedback.
    7. Iterate based on comments.

    Pro script / template: “If you have 5 screens, connect them all. Then send the prototype link to 3 people and ask them to complete a task. Note where they hesitate.”

    📊 Expected results: Catch 30% of usability issues before visual design begins.


    Phase 2: High-Fidelity UI Design

    Now you add color, typography, icons, and spacing. High-fi prototypes look and feel like the final product. They are essential for stakeholder approval and user testing with real customers.

    Tactic 2.1: Establish a Design System

    Why this works: A design system ensures consistency. According to Figma’s 2025 State of Design report, teams with a design system ship 2x faster.

    Exactly how to do it:

    1. Define primary and secondary color palette in styles.
    2. Choose 2-3 fonts (headings, body, accent).
    3. Create reusable components (buttons, inputs, cards).
    4. Set grid and spacing tokens (4px base).
    5. Use auto-layout for responsive elements.
    6. Name components in ‘Components’ panel.
    7. Publish to team library for reuse.

    Pro script / template: “Create a color style for primary (hex #FF4C00) and apply it to all CTAs. Use the ‘Components’ shortcut (Option+Command+K) to turn a button into a master component.”

    📊 Expected results: 50% faster high-fi conversion from wireframes.

    Tactic 2.2: Convert Wireframes to High-Fi

    Why this works: Replacing grayscale blocks with real content and color makes the prototype tangible and testable.

    Exactly how to do it:

    1. Replace gray image placeholders with actual images (use Unsplash plugin).
    2. Update lorem ipsum with real copy (avoid placeholder text).
    3. Apply color styles from design system.
    4. Add icons using icon plugins or vector shapes.
    5. Use auto-layout to maintain spacing.
    6. Ensure text and background contrast meets WCAG AA.
    7. Review for brand alignment.

    Pro script / template: “Set up a ‘Before’ and ‘After’ page in your file so stakeholders see the transformation. Use Shift+Enter to duplicate wireframes and keep the draft.”

    📊 Expected results: Polished screens ready for client presentation.

    Tactic 2.3: Add Micro-Copy and Error States

    Why this works: Real UX includes error messages, empty states, and success confirmations. Prototyping these reduces back-and-forth during development.

    Exactly how to do it:

    1. Identify 3 common error scenarios (invalid email, empty cart, network error).
    2. Design a dedicated error component with icon and message.
    3. Add success states for form submissions.
    4. Design empty states with illustrations and a call to action.
    5. Connect these states in the prototype (e.g., error after wrong input).
    6. Test error paths with users.
    7. Iterate based on confusion points.

    Pro script / template: “For a login screen, create a variant component for ‘error’ state. In prototype, set interaction: after clicking submit if email is empty, navigate to error state.”

    📊 Expected results: Reduces development bugs by 25% (Usability.gov data).

    Phase 3: Interaction & Animation

    Interactions make a prototype feel real. In 2026, users expect micro-interactions, smooth transitions, and feedback. This phase separates amateurs from pros.

    Tactic 3.1: Master Smart Animate

    Why this works: Smart Animate creates seamless morphing animations between layers with the same name. It’s the most powerful prototyping tool in Figma.

    Exactly how to do it:

    1. Ensure two frames share a layer with the same name (e.g., ‘Product Card’).
    2. Change the layer’s properties (position, size, color, rotation).
    3. Connect frames via the Prototype tab with ‘Smart Animate’ animation.
    4. Set easing (ease-in-out works for most).
    5. Adjust duration (300ms is standard).
    6. Preview and tweak timing.
    7. Use for list-to-detail transitions, menu animations, or toggle switches.

    Pro script / template: “For a product detail expander: name the image ‘Product Image’ in both the list and detail frame. Move it from small to large, and set Smart Animate → 300ms → ease-in-out.”

    📊 Expected results: 30% higher engagement in user testing.

    Tactic 3.2: Add Overlays and Tooltips

    Why this works: Overlays provide contextual information without leaving the current screen. They mimic modals and drop-downs.

    Exactly how to do it:

    1. Create a new frame (smaller, like 300×200) for the overlay.
    2. Design the overlay content (e.g., tooltip text, menu items).
    3. In prototype, select the trigger element (e.g., icon).
    4. Drag connection to overlay frame.
    5. Choose ‘Open Overlay’ action.
    6. Set position (centered, top, etc.).
    7. Add a close button that triggers ‘Close overlay’.

    Pro script / template: “For a tooltip on a ‘?’ icon: create a small frame (200×100) with white background and shadow. Connect the icon to the frame with ‘Open Overlay’ centered. Set a delay of 300ms if hover.”

    📊 Expected results: 15% higher user confidence (UX Planet study).

    Tactic 3.3: Use After Delay Triggers

    Why this works: Auto-advancing prototypes (e.g., onboarding carousels) feel more polished and reduce manual clicks.

    Exactly how to do it:

    1. Select the first frame of the carousel.
    2. In prototype, add an interaction with ‘After delay’ trigger.
    3. Set delay e.g., 3 seconds.
    4. Navigate to the next frame.
    5. Repeat for all slides.
    6. Add a pause/play button as alternative.
    7. Test on mobile view.

    Pro script / template: “For an onboarding flow: set each screen to auto-advance after 4 seconds. Add a ‘Skip’ overlay that closes and goes to the main app. Use Smart Animate for smooth transitions.”

    📊 Expected results: 20% increase in completion rate for onboarding flows.


    Phase 4: Testing & Handoff

    Even the best prototype needs validation. A 2026 Nielsen study shows that prototypes tested with 5 users find 85% of usability issues. Then, you must hand off to developers with clear specs.

    Tactic 4.1: Conduct Guerrilla User Testing

    Why this works: Quick, low-cost testing with 5 users catches major issues. You don’t need a lab — just a laptop and a quiet corner.

    Exactly how to do it:

    1. Set a task (e.g., ‘Sign up for a newsletter’).
    2. Open prototype in Present mode.
    3. Ask user to think aloud.
    4. Note where they hesitate or fail.
    5. Record session (with permission).
    6. Analyze results: find top 3 pain points.
    7. Iterate prototype based on feedback.

    Pro script / template: “Recruit 5 people from your office or local cafe. Offer a ৳200 bKash incentive. Use a simple spreadsheet to track successes and failures per task.”

    📊 Expected results: 85% of usability issues identified in one day.

    Tactic 4.2: Use Figma’s Commenting & Approval

    Why this works: Embedded comments keep feedback in-context and prevent version confusion.

    Exactly how to do it:

    1. Share prototype with stakeholders (set to ‘Can view’ or ‘Can comment’).
    2. Ask them to comment directly on elements.
    3. Use ‘Resolve’ button to mark done.
    4. Create a ‘Feedback’ frame for general questions.
    5. Set deadlines for comments.
    6. Use branch and merge for major changes.
    7. Lock final version after approval.

    Pro script / template: “In the share dialog, enable ‘Allow comments’ and ‘Allow viewers to copy’ to encourage feedback. Pin the link in your project Slack channel with a deadline.”

    📊 Expected results: Approval time reduced by 40%.

    Tactic 4.3: Generate Dev Specs Automatically

    Why this works: Developers need exact measurements, colors, and assets. Figma’s Inspect mode provides CSS, iOS, and Android code snippets.

    Exactly how to do it:

    1. Ensure all layers are properly named and grouped.
    2. Use auto-layout for spacing.
    3. Export assets (PNG, SVG, PDF) via ‘Export’ panel.
    4. Share the file link with developers, set to ‘Can view’.
    5. Show them Inspect mode (right panel).
    6. Discuss grid and breakpoints.
    7. Provide a style guide page with tokens.

    Pro script / template: “Create a ‘Handoff’ page in your Figma file. Include: frame with developer notes, exported icons folder, and a link to the design system documentation.”

    📊 Expected results: 35% faster implementation with fewer clarification rounds.

    ❓ Frequently Asked Questions

    Q: What is a Figma prototype?

    A Figma prototype is an interactive simulation of a user interface that allows designers to test navigation and interactions before development. It connects screens via hotspots and transitions, providing a clickable experience.

    Q: How long does it take to design a Figma prototype?

    For a simple flow (5-10 screens), a designer can create a low-fi prototype in 1-2 hours. High-fidelity prototypes with animations may take 8-16 hours depending on complexity. With practice, we’ve seen our team at Rafirit Station deliver polished prototypes in under 4 hours for standard projects.

    Q: Is Figma free for prototyping?

    Yes, Figma offers a free tier with robust prototyping features. You can create unlimited prototypes with basic interactions. Paid plans ($12/month for professional) unlock advanced animations, user testing tools, and team libraries.

    Q: What’s the difference between a wireframe and a prototype?

    A wireframe is a low-fidelity layout focusing on structure and hierarchy, often grayscale. A prototype adds interactivity and visual design, showing how users actually click through a flow. Wireframes are static; prototypes are dynamic.

    Q: Can I share a Figma prototype without a paid account?

    Absolutely. Figma’s free plan allows you to share prototypes via a public link. You can set permissions (view-only or comment) and send the link to stakeholders. No account needed for viewers.

    Q: How do I add interactions in Figma?

    In Figma, interactions are created using the ‘Prototype’ tab. Select an element, drag the arrow to a destination frame, and choose a trigger (on click, drag, while hovering) and action (navigate to, open overlay, scroll to, etc.). You can set animations like dissolve, move in, or push.

    Q: What is the difference between ‘Smart Animate’ and ‘Move In’?

    Smart Animate automatically animates matching layers between frames if they have the same name, creating smooth morphing effects. Move In slides the entire screen. Smart Animate is great for micro-interactions, while Move In works for full-screen transitions.
